Text: | Lord, to Thee I Make Confession |
Author: | Johann Franck |
1 Lord, to Thee I make confession,
I have sinned and gone astray,
I have multiplied transgression,
Chosen for myself the way.
Forced at last to see my errors,
Lord, I tremble at Thy terrors.
2 Though my conscience doth appall me,
Father, I will seek Thy face;
Though Thy child I dare not call me,
Yet receive me to Thy grace;
For my sins do not forsake me,
O let not Thy wrath o'ertake me.
3 For Thy Son hath suffered for me,
And the blood He shed for sin
Can to life and faith restore me,
Quench this burning fire within;
'Tis alone His cross can vanquish
These dark fears, and soothe this anguish.
4 Then on Him I cast my burden,
Sink it in the depths below;
Let me feel Thy gracious pardon,
Wash me, make me white as snow.
Let Thy Spirit leave me never,
Make me Thine alone forever!
Amen.
